Apple Devices Now Officially Support 8BitDo Ultimate 2 Wireless Controller

The 8BitDo Ultimate 2 Wireless Controller, famed for its versatility and top-notch design, now boasts official compatibility with Apple devices. Previously limited to Windows and Android, this controller is now ready to enhance your gaming experience on iOS, iPadOS, macOS, tvOS, and visionOS platforms.

Unveiled by 8BitDo earlier this year, the Ultimate 2 Wireless Controller impresses with its multi-mode connectivity options. While it connects to Windows via a wired USB or 2.4GHz wireless adapter, its apparent connection to Apple devices likely relies on Bluetooth. This expanded functionality was proudly announced on X by 8BitDo’s official account.

The controller is crafted with an Xbox-style layout featuring TMR joysticks, Hall Effect triggers that support mode switching, and additional customizable buttons. Noteworthy are its RGB-lit joysticks, six-axis motion control, turbo functionality, and macro options. To top it all, it comes with a convenient charging dock.

Available in striking colors including Black, Purple, White, Green, and a special Wuchang: Fallen Feathers edition, the controller is competitively priced.
